What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in computer recycling?

To excel in computer recycling, you need a basic understanding of computer hardware, safe dismantling techniques, and adherence to environmental and data security regulations. Familiarity with e-waste management systems, data destruction tools, and relevant certifications like R2 (Responsible Recycling) or e-Stewards can be highly beneficial. Attention to detail, reliability, and strong teamwork skills help ensure efficiency and safety on the job. These abilities are essential for responsibly handling sensitive materials and electronics, minimizing environmental impact, and upholding regulatory standards.

What is a computer recycling?

A Computer Recycling job involves collecting, sorting, dismantling, and properly disposing of or refurbishing old and unwanted computers and electronic devices. Workers ensure that hazardous materials like batteries and circuit boards are handled safely and that reusable components are salvaged for resale or reuse. This role helps reduce electronic waste and promotes environmentally responsible disposal practices. Some positions may also include data destruction services to protect sensitive information before recycling or repurposing devices.

About AWR
Austin Wood Recycling (AWR) has rooted itself in service since 1987, cultivating a family-owned atmosphere in the pursuit of responsible stewardship of the land. Our goal is to give back to nature by recycling the collected materials from suburban and urban improvement projects using sustainable, environmentally friendly land-clearing practices. We strive to respect our natural resources by recycling all organic material; thereby reducing environmental strain and preventing landfill waste.
By creating our line of premium Texas Nativeยฎ landscape products from recycled organic materials, we're proud to manufacture goods from a byproduct of development. And as the nation's largest contract grinding company, the AWR family is committed to continued growth with Texas and our customers across the United States, using safe, environmentally sound construction and manufacturing methods; exceeding customer expectations by delivering on time, with friendliness and dependability.
